About:China Visa Application in UK

I am based in London but need a visa to enter Hong kong.

I am hoping to attend a 3 day trade fair in Guangzhou on the mainland later this month, but hope to visit Hongkong and stay in a hotel there. I am based in London but need a visa to enter Hong kong.
Is there a visa that covers entry to both Hongkong and the mainland?

May I know which country's passport are you holding? Hk SAR has its own entry ans exit regulations different from mainland China, so there isn't a visa that allows your entry and stay both in HK and Guangzhou.

HK SAR is very open to foreign visitors, citizens of most countries enjoy a certain period of visa free access to Hk.
